I have one more question for you. I bought a swash plate leveler a while back. I gave it a try and noticed that when I give it full throttle, the the elevator is about 1/8" lower than the Aileron and pitch. It's even on all three points with no throttle.

The best way is to level the swash at mid point ie zero pitch and not at max neg pitch then the error will decrease hopefully to insignificant. Throttle and collective are on the same stick direction but are different functions. How is your pitch curve set and is it linear.

That may be suitable for your current flying style but for setup purposes it needs to be 0%,25%,50%,75%,100%. Then the servos should center at 50% and the blades and flybar paddles should be level at zero pitch by mechanically adjusting the relevant rods.

Not sure what you are looking at but I can only assume it's the reciever because FM only 5 ports.
The sticky at the top on the section explains how to connect the servos to FM and it's the same for all makes of TX/RX's.
I wrote the sticky because the manuel is poor please read and follow it.
Looking at the heli from the rear the servo that operates the left side of the swash connect to port 1 on the FM moduel. the servo that controls the right hand side of the swash connect to port 3 on FM and the servo that controls the rear of the swash connect to port 2 on FM. Hope this helps.
